Hard Start/rough idle when warm

I have an early 99 with 156K miles. I put a new 17* HPOP in it last spring. Ever since then every once in awhile it takes forever to start after its been driven. It doesnt do this all the time. It starts awesome cold, idles great and it has awesome power. After it has been driven it idles like crap, and starts really hard but seems to have awesome power.

I have pulled the IPR and cleaned it up, waiting now for the new o-rings to put it back together. The old o-rings looked fine, no cracks etc. Could there be a problem with the 17* hpop that I put in it ? It was a remanufactured one I purchased from Ebay. Thanks in advance.

That sounds more like a internal oil leak. I'm not sure if the 7.3 has dummy plugs, but that is the common cause for hard or no stars when the 6.0 is warmed up. I can do more research and get back.
